了解IPv4和IPv6之间的区别(简述ipv4和ipv6的区别)

了解IPv4和IPv6之间的区别(简述ipv4和ipv6的区别)

浏览次数:
信息来源: 用户投稿
更新日期: 2026-04-01
文章简介

互联网协议或IP是一组规则,使我们的计算机和其他通信设备可以通过互联网相互连接。每当您在浏览器上打开一个网站时,带有您的IP地址的数据包就会发送到网络服务器自己的IP地址,之后该网站将通过互联网返回到

2025阿里云双十一服务器活动

互联网协议或IP是一组规则,使我们的计算机和其他通信设备可以通过互联网相互连接。每当您在浏览器上打开一个网站时,带有您的IP地址的数据包就会发送到网络服务器自己的IP地址,之后该网站将通过互联网返回到您的设备。

IP地址的运作方式与地图上街道地址的运作方式相同。他们将数据包定向到预期的目的地。IP控制所有互联网流量。带有源点和目的地IP信息的数据包在Internet上传输,路由器帮助将它们引导到正确的路径。

IP是TCP/IP的另一半,即所谓的Internet协议族。TCP,传输控制协议,管理传输层,而IP则与网络层有关。TCP/IP由美国国防部高级研究计划局(DARPA)开发。它于1982年成为美国军方的计算机网络标准。不久之后,它成为互联网等分组交换网络的主要标准。

IPv4和IPv6分别代表Internet协议版本4和版本6。目前这两个版本共存,一旦IPv4地址用完,IPv6将接管。IPv4和IPv6之间的主要区别是什么?让我们找出来。

IPv4是一种无连接协议,以尽力而为的交付模式运行,这意味着它不保证交付,也不能避免重复。TCP位于IP之上,通过数据完整性检查等机制解决了这些缺点。

IPv4于1981年成为管理数据包传输的主要协议。在标准定义期间,版本号进展迅速,从版本1开始,直到IPv4于1983年成为ARPANET(互联网的先驱)中使用的版本。

最初,IP地址被设计为仅支持少量网络。到1981年IPv4推出时,它已经在有类网络寻址体系结构中划分为地址类以应对这一限制。这种架构在1993年被取代,当时引入了无类域间路由(CIDR)以减缓IPv4地址耗尽和互联网上路由表的快速增长。

IPv4地址是数字,使用点分十进制表示法或由点分隔的四个十进制八位字节格式化,例如,172.217.31.238。由于一个八位字节的长度为八位,对于四个八位字节,每个IPv4地址的长度为32位或四个字节。

在232个IP地址中,IPv4地址总数接近43亿。如果排除为多播和专用网络保留的大约3亿个地址,这个数字将下降到大约40亿。网络地址转换(NAT)用于允许为专用网络保留的IP地址通过Internet进行通信。

最初人们认为IPv4可以为互联网上的所有设备提供IP地址,但很快就发现需要更强大的替代方案来满足未来的需求,即使IPv4地址可以重复使用。随着访问互联网的设备数量已经达到数十亿,尤其是智能手机和物联网(IoT)已经无处不在,几乎所有IPv4地址都已分配——进入IPv6。

随着1990年代互联网使用的兴起,负责定义技术互联网协议的开放标准机构互联网工程任务组(IETF)开始意识到IPv4中的一个潜在问题:它可以生成的可用IP地址数量有限并且在可预见的未来将不足以分配给访问互联网的设备。

IETF决定需要一个更好的面向未来的IP寻址标准。到1998年,它提出了一个更好和改进的IPv6标准草案,旨在最终取代IPv4。

IPv6提供了一个128位的IP地址。这意味着它允许生成2^128个或大约3.4×10^38个地址。通俗地说,IPv6地址的数量可以是数万亿万亿。

由于IPv6还保留了一些号码块供特殊使用或完全排除使用某些号码,因此IPv6地址的实际数量应该略少,就像在IPv4中一样。尽管如此,IPv6地址的数量实际上是无限的,应该足以满足未来的需求。

虽然IPv6遵循与IPv4相同的设计原则,但IPv6地址分为八组,每组四个十六进制数字,每组由冒号分隔,例如fe80:0000:0000:0350:9804:1781:4371:2d03。大多数IPv6地址不会占用其所有128位,导致字段仅包含零或用零填充。

使用IPv6寻址架构,您可以使用两个冒号(::)来表示连续的16位零字段。例如,您可以将fe80:0000:0000:0350:9804:1781:4371:2d03折叠成fe80::0350:9804:1781:4371:2d03以使其更具可读性。

IPv4和IPv6之间最显着的区别是后者允许的IP地址数量实际上是无限的。当IPv4出现时,移动设备还没有普及。因此,构建IPv4时没有考虑移动网络和支持物联网的设备。当这些设备上网并连接到互联网时,它们会通过NAT间接通过。此过程有时会给IPv4设备带来问题。

随着移动设备互联网访问现在成为标准,转向IPv6势在必行,因为它允许设备之间更简化的通信。考虑到IPv6为移动网络提供的优势,移动网络率先采用IPv6也就不足为奇了。IPv6允许单个设备拥有多个IP地址,具体取决于该设备的使用方式。每台设备都使用自己分配的IP地址直接连接到互联网,而不是通过NAT。

当IPv4出现时,网络安全还不是任何人最关心的问题。IPv4的更新允许它配置与IPv6相同的IP安全标准。尽管IPv6旨在通过其内置的加密功能和数据包完整性检查来提高安全性,但IPv4也可以提高安全性,因此在Internet协议安全性(IPsec)方面它们之间基本上没有区别。

IPv4需要地址解析协议(ARP)才能映射到设备的物理地址或媒体访问控制(MAC)地址。ARP容易受到欺骗,并且可以成为网络上的中间人攻击或拒绝服务攻击的载体。尽管可以通过使用旨在防止此类攻击的软件来减轻这种风险,但它仍然会带来问题。

为了映射到设备的MAC地址,IPv6使用更强大的邻居发现协议(NDP)及其相关扩展,包括安全邻居发现协议(SEND),这是一种提供加密地址和公钥基础设施(PKI)的安全扩展,与IPv6中固有的IPsec。因此,尽管IPv4中存在IP安全性,但在安全方面,IPv4和IPv6之间仍然存在差异。

至于设备配置,IPv4可能需要大量手动配置或使用动态主机配置协议(DHCP)进行辅助配置。相反,自动配置适用于每个具有IPv6地址的设备。同样,在设备配置方面,IPv6毫无疑问地胜出。

由于多年来已经成熟和改进,IPv4的执行速度与IPv6相当,理论上更快,因为它不需要NAT。IPv6网络性能应该很快就会超过IPv4网络,因为网络管理员变得更加善于优化它们,就像他们已经学会了调整IPv4网络一样。

特征

IPv4

IPv6

地址大小

32位

128位

寻址方式

IPv4是一个数字地址。它使用点分符号来

分隔二进制八位字节。

IPv6是一个字母数字地址。它使用冒号

班级数

有五个等级,A到E。

它允许无限数量的IP地址。

地址类型

单播、多播、广播

单播、多播和任播

标头字段数

标头字段的长度

校验和字段

有校验和字段

没有校验和字段

数据包大小

IPv4的最小数据包大小为576字节。

IPv4的最小数据包大小为1208字节。

测绘

IPv4使用地址解析协议(ARP)将

IP地址映射到媒体访问控制(MAC)地址。

了解IPv4和IPv6之间的区别,简述ipv4和ipv6的区别

动态主机配置服务器(DHCS)

客户端在连接到网络之前向DHCS请求IP地址。

客户有永久地址。不需要

简单网络管理协议(SNMP)

IPv4使用SNMP进行系统管理。

IPv6不使用SNMP

与移动设备的兼容性

IPv4使用点十进制表示法,不适

IPv6使用十六进制冒号分隔表示法,

本地子网组管理

IPv4使用互联网组管理协议(GMP)

IPv6使用多播侦听器发现(MLD)。

互操作性和移动性

因此,它限制了网络拓扑,阻碍了

它具有嵌入

网络设备的互操作性和移动性功能。

子网掩码

指定网络使用主机部分的子网掩码。

它不使用子网掩码。

路由信息协议(RIP)

IPv4支持RIP

IPv6不支持RIP

地址功能

IPv4使用网络地址转换(NAT),允许

单个地址屏蔽多个不可路由的地址。

IPv6由于其庞大的地址空间而使用直接寻址。

安全

安全性取决于应用程序。

IPv6在协议中内置了互联网协议安全(IPsec)

,以提供自动安全性。

可选字段

有可选字段

它没有可选字段。它提供扩展头。

由于IPv6,最终耗尽IP地址的危险已经过去。IPv6中更多的地址并不是它相对于IPv4的唯一优势。

IPv6中的分层地址分配解决了IPv4中日益复杂的路由表问题,这个问题之前已通过CIDR解决。IPv6寻址非常简单,不会对路由器造成问题。使用IPv6,CIDR不再是必不可少的,但您仍然可以将其用于路由器配置。

此外,IPv6具有一种新的数据包格式,旨在进行最少的路由器处理。因此,IPv6应该使网络管理更容易、路由更有效以及设备移动性更好。由于IPv6的数据包格式与IPv4的不同,因此这两个IP标准不能互操作。IETF已尝试减轻这种不互操作性引起的潜在问题;到目前为止,这些措施已被证明是成功的,可以确保这两个标准可以一起运行而不会出现任何重大问题。

IPv6具有优势的另一个领域是多播寻址,它允许设备同时向多个目的地发送带宽密集型数据包,例如多媒体流。

IPv6还提供更简单的配置。它允许同时连接到多个网络,这在IPv4中是不可能的。虽然IPv6仍然可以使用静态IP地址或DHCP,但它可以利用无状态自动配置。这允许与网络上的前缀和路由器无缝集成,同时使IPv6设备能够使用唯一的64位标识符自动为自己分配地址。这种自动配置功能是IPv6非常适合用于支持物联网的设备的原因。

IPv6的其他好处包括开箱即用的更好安全性。使用IPv6,不再需要ping扫描,消除了蠕虫在您的网络中传播的潜在载体。不利的一面是,这会使DNS服务器成为攻击者的潜在目标。

IPv6的其他缺点包括需要升级不是为IPv6设计的网络设备。

事实证明,输入和记住由字母和数字组成的过长IPv6地址并将它们放入网络拓扑图中也很困难。虽然这听起来微不足道,但如果您管理的是大型网络,它可能会被证明是困难和麻烦的。您还必须记住在开始迁移到IPv6时同时启用IPv6路由和禁用IPv4路由。

从IPv4迁移到IPv6可能会很复杂,因为这两种协议不向后兼容。这可能意味着在开始时手动分配新的IP地址。随着网络最终过渡到IPv6,这个过程应该会减少问题。

为了最大限度地降低迁移到IPv6时的成本,公司可以采取一种策略,使他们能够利用现有的IPv4基础设施,同时利用IPv6提供的优势。您可以选择拥有一个双栈网络,让您的硬件在两种协议上运行,并尽可能使用IPv6,而不是完全用IPv6替换IPv4。这种方法是可行的,因为它得到了主要供应商的支持。

虽然IPv4和IPv6目前共存,但它们并非设计为可互操作。IETF制定了多项策略,以确保在准备向IPv6过渡时这两种协议可以共存。这些允许IPv4和IPv6主机相互通信。最终,IPv6地址将成为常态,但这可能还需要几年时间。

愿意迁移到IPv6的ISP和移动运营商的数量,以及大型组织、云提供商和数据中心的数量,以及他们将如何迁移数据,将决定未来IPv6的使用方式。在并行网络上,IPv4和IPv6可以共存。因此,ISP等机构没有强烈的动力去探索IPv6而不是IPv4,尤其是因为升级需要大量时间和金钱。

尽管付出了代价,但数字世界正逐渐从低效的IPv4模型迁移到更高效的IPv6模型。IPv6的长期利益。

虽然预期的向IPv6的全面转变尚未发生,但世界各地的互联网注册机构已经用完了IPv4地址。IPv6采用缓慢背后的最大因素是NAT,它允许在公共互联网上使用相对狭窄范围的私有IPv4地址。由于NAT为有限数量的IPv4地址提供了一种解决方法,企业网络并没有仓促转向IPv6。

向IPv6的过渡一直很缓慢。尽管IPv6的部署始于2006年,但IPv6本身直到2017年才成为正式的互联网标准。

随着互联网注册机构拉响警报,IPv6现在准备在IP寻址领域占据中心位置。尽管它经历了二十多年的成熟,但近年来获得了广泛的关注。

移动网络,紧随其后的是互联网服务提供商(ISP),引领了IPv6的采用。主要网站也已开始过渡到IPv6。落后的是企业,他们在IPv4网络上的现有投资阻碍了他们的发展。

迁移到IPv6时遇到的问题使IPv6的采用变得更糟。例如,与IPv6相关的Windows10错误延迟了微软2017年在其西雅图总部向IPv6过渡的努力。

IPv4可能还会存在几年,甚至十年,因为更换IPv4设备的成本很高。这并不是说您不应该采用IPv6。您的组织应该开始采用IPv6,以避免以后出现任何重大问题。

标签:
什么是Kubernetes命名空间(kubernetes配置文件)
« 上一篇
返回列表
下一篇 »

如本文对您有帮助,就请抽根烟吧!